Transaction 34e03735ae0c52f6b819920891b7489d4309b49d32494fda4a9bb9a81000978b

72 Input
2 Outputs
  • 34e03735ae0c52f6b819920891b7489d4309b49d32494fda4a9bb9a81000978b:0
  • value  920782
    address  3EwgVqAFNt4qS3fM4MkEz2GxLsG7R6YXVQ
  • 34e03735ae0c52f6b819920891b7489d4309b49d32494fda4a9bb9a81000978b:1
  • value  1752181157
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s